Goddard, Ken
Wildfire
New York, Forge, a Tom Doherty Associates Book, 1994. Publisher representative's copy. Softcover. Size: 8vo 8" - 9" tall. Uncommon in the trade in this state, a softcover copy, with unfurled tips, tight binding, and clean internals but for "REP" ink-stamped at first free endpaper and a remainder mark along bottom edge, else with only very slight shelf- and edge-wear. Orange card stock wraps, protected in a plastic sleeve. From the publisher's blurb, "Henry Lightstone, Fish and Wildlife Department undercover expert, and his crack team of wildlife agents are back in business on the cutting edge of environmental protection. Running a covert investigation, Lightstone stumbles across the activities of a vicious professional assassin and discovers a link to an old nemesis: the ICER Committee, a ruthless junta of international industrialists and financiers bent on destroying the environmental movement through violence and terror." 377 pp.Member, I.O.B.A., C.B.A., and adherent to the highest ethical standards. . . .
